Amos Hochstein Talks Iran Oil Exports
US sanctions have succeeded in reducing the amount of oil Iran exports, a White House energy adviser said Thursday. Iranian oil exports have been cut from as much as 3 million barrels a day to as little as 1 million barrels a day, President Joe Biden’s energy security adviser Amos Hochstein speaks with Bloomberg Surveillance hosts Jon Ferro, Lisa Abramowicz and Annmarie HordernSee om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.

A Conversation About Middle East Boycotts Hitting Global Brands
Many shoppers in the Middle East, as well as in Muslim nations like Pakistan are shunning big foreign brands, driven by a wellspring of anger against Western countries for their support of Israel during the war with Hamas. In this special podcast, Bloomberg reporters Leen Al-Rashdan and Salma El Wardany discuss the effects of the boycott movements, speak to those who've changed their spending habits, and to businesses who've seen an increase in sales as consumers make the switch to more local brands.
